It arises from the judgements rather than the techniques. Forms of knowledge acquisition and utilization must be reinvented so that there is a close and equal partnership among the profession, practitioners and students. This will enable social workers to discover, articulate and use their knowledge most effectively.enThe nature of practice wisdom in social work revisitedjournal article10.1177/0020872807083915
